    Tunable solid-state dye laser doped by Chromen-3 and PM-567

    Solid-state active laser media using PMMA matrices doped by Chromene-3 and PM-567 were created. Their lasing and spectral properties are investigated. Fluorescence bandwidth is wide enough for tunability (near 40 nm full-width on the half maximum - FWHM). The photostability is number of the pulses in one dot needed to decrease efficiency twice – near of 3*105 pulses are obtained. The obtained data lead to the development of the tunable solid-state laser on the basis of the investigated LAE demanded in medicine

    Risk Assessment at the Cosmetic Product Manufacturer by Expert Judgment Method

    A case study was performed in a cosmetic product manufacturer. We have identified the main risk factors of occupational accidents and their causes. Risk of accidents is assessed by the expert judgment method. Event tree for the most probable accident is built and recommendations on improvement of occupational health and safety protection system at the cosmetic product manufacturer are developed. The results of this paper can be used to develop actions to improve the occupational safety and health system in the chemical industry

    Study of the bipolar jet of the YSO Th 28 with VLT/SINFONI: Jet morphology and H2_2 emission

    Context.Context. The YSO Th 28 possesses a highly collimated jet, which clearly exhibits an asymmetric brightness of its jet lobes at optical and NIR wavelengths. There may be asymmetry in the jet plasma parameters in opposite jet lobes (e.g. electron density, temperature, and outflow velocity). Aims.Aims. We examined the Th 28 jet in a 3"x3" where the jet material is collimated and accelerated. Our goal is to map the morphology and determine its physical parameters to determine the physical origin of such asymmetries. Methods.Methods. We present JHKJHK-spectra of Th 28 obtained with the SINFONI on the (VLT, ESO) in June-July 2015. Results.Results. The [Fe II] emission originates in collimated jet lobes. Two new axial knots are detected at 1" in the blue lobe and 1".2 in the red lobe. The H2_2 radiation is emitted from an extended region with a radius of 270\gtrsim270 au, which is perpendicular to the jet. The PV diagrams of the bright H2_2 lines reveal faint H2_2 emission along both jet lobes as well. The compact and faint H I emission (Paβ\beta and Brγ\gamma) comes from two regions, namely from a spherical region around the star and from the jet lobes. The size of the jet launching region is derived as 0".015 (\sim3 au at 185 pc), and the initial opening angle of the Th 28 jet is 280\sim28^0, which makes this jet substantially less collimated than most jets from other CTTs. Conclusions.Conclusions. The emission in [Fe II], H2_2, and H I lines suggests a morphology in which the ionised gas in the disc appears to be disrupted by the jet. The resolved disc-like H2_2 emission most likely arises in the disc atmosphere from shocks caused by a radial uncollimated wind. The asymmetry of the [Fe II] photocentre shifts with respect to the jet source arises in the immediate vicinity of the driving source of Th28 and suggests that the observed brightness asymmetry is intrinsic as well.Comment: 18 pages, 14 figure

    ВЗАИМНЫЕ ЭФФЕКТЫ САХАРНОГО ДИАБЕТА, ОЖИРЕНИЯ И SARS-COV-2

    С момента первой вспышки SARS-Cov-2 в Китае большое внимание медицинского сообщества было уделено людям с сахарным диабетом, так как хорошо известно, что сахарный диабет повышает риск развития ряда инфекционных заболеваний. Причина этого многофакторная: возраст, пол, этническая принадлежность, сопутствующие заболевания, такие как гипертония, сердечно-сосудистые заболевания, ожирение, а также провоспалительное и прокоагулянтное состояние – все это способствует более тяжелому течению SARS-Cov-2 у пациентов с сахарным диабетом. Более того, тяжелая инфекция SARS-Cov-2 сама по себе может представлять собой ухудшающий фактор для людей с сахарным диабетом, поскольку она может вызвать острые метаболические осложнения через прямое негативное воздействие на функцию β-клеток. Данный обзор призван обеспечить системную оценку потенциальных прогностических факторов и взаимных эффектов у пациентов с сахарным диабетом, ожирением и SARS-Cov-2

    Environmental Behavior of Youth and Sustainable Development

    The relationship between people and nature is one of the most important current issues of human survival. This circumstance makes it necessary to educate young people who are receptive to global challenges and ready to solve the urgent problems of our time. The purpose of the article is to analyze the experience of the environmental behavior of young people in the metropolis. The authors studied articles and monographs that contain Russian and international experience in the environmental behavior of citizens. The following factors determine people’s behavior: the cognitive capabilities of people who determine the understanding and perception of nature and the value-affective component that determines the attitude towards nature. The next task of the study is surveying young people through an online survey and its analysis. The research was realized in Ekaterinburg, the administrative center of the Sverdlovsk region (Russia). The study of the current ecological situation in Ekaterinburg made it possible to conclude that the environmental problem arises not only and not simply as a problem of environmental pollution and other negative influences of human economic activity. This problem grows into transforming the spontaneous impact of society on nature into a consciously, purposefully, systematically developing harmonious interaction with it. The study results showed that, from the point of view of the youth of Ekaterinburg, the city’s ecological situation is one of the most pressing problems. Despite minor improvements over the past 3–5 years, this problem has not lost relevance, and regional authorities and city residents should be responsible for its solution. Young people know environmental practices, but they often do not apply them systematically. Ecological behavior is encouraged and discussed among friends/acquaintances. The key factors influencing the formation of environmental behavior practices are the mass media and social networks. The most popular social network for obtaining information on ecological practices among young people is Instagram, and the key persons are bloggers. This study did not reveal the influence of the socio-demographic characteristics of young people on the application of eco-behavior practices, which may indicate the need for a survey of a larger sample. © 2021 by the authors.
